Enzyme Information

2.1.1.128
(RS)-norcoclaurine 6-O-methyltransferase.
based on mapping to UniProt Q5C9L7
S-adenosyl-L-methionine + (RS)-norcoclaurine = S-adenosyl-L-homocysteine + (RS)-coclaurine.
-!- The enzyme will also catalyze the 6-O-methylation of (RS)- norlaudanosoline to form 6-O-methyl-norlaudanosoline, but this alkaloid has not been found to occur in plants.
